Browser VI

I know that there is a VI used to start up your web browser and load a specified page, but I'll be damned if I can find it in the many supplied LLBs.

Can anyone point me in the right direction?

In the help directory there is a folder called intlinks. Inside of
there are two LLBs that LV uses to connect a person to various NI web
sites that are deemed useful. If you use that you will have a platform
independent way of firing up a web browser to a particular URL. Note
that some of the VIs in intlinks.llb will run when opened; so you should
drop them as subVIs using VI... then open them up and figure out how
they work.
